    We were traveling through the town of Cross Plains and needed a place to eat. Husband was in the mood for BBQ, so after a quick call to insure the place was open, we chose Bubba's. The employees were very friendly, and the food arrived in a reasonable amount of time. Husband got the Cajun Tater, a huge mountain of potato, butter, meat, topped with Bubba's crawfish and shrimp etoufee, and finished with shredded cheese, sour cream and green onions. I would have sworn he couldn't finish that beast, but he found it delicious and not only finished it, but ate the skin! I ordered a Senior plate, and got a serving of sliced brisket, fries, sweet potato casserole and peach cobbler. My opinion: the brisket was average plus, the fries were delicious and fresh, the sweet potato casserole was dry, and the peach cobbler was made from canned peaches, with a seasoned cracker topping, no ice cream. This place was a hit or miss, with the Cajun Tater taking first place and my meal a distant last.
